The KXF0E3RRA00 vacuum pump filter is a high‑performance replacement filter cartridge designed specifically for CM402 and CM602 modular placement machines, as well as compatible SMT pick‑and‑place equipment. Also referenced under part number N41444, this air filter element is a critical consumable component that protects the vacuum generation system from airborne contaminants, ensuring consistent component pickup, placement accuracy, and long‑term equipment reliability.

Within CM402 and CM602 SMT placement machines, the KXF0E3RRA00 vacuum pump filter sits upstream of the vacuum pump assembly. Ambient air drawn into the system passes through this filter element before entering the pump mechanism. The filter effectively captures dust, paper fibers from tape‑and‑reel packaging, solder flux residue particles, and other fine particulates present in the SMT production environment.

What is a dust collector filter used for?

Dust collector filters remove airborne dust and particulate matter from industrial processes such as welding, grinding, woodworking, and powder handling to protect equipment and improve air quality.

How often should dust collector filter cartridges be replaced?

Replacement depends on dust load, operating hours, and cleaning efficiency. A consistent increase in pressure drop is a common indicator that the filter needs replacement.

Can dust collector filters be cleaned and reused?

Many cartridge filters are designed for pulse-jet cleaning, but they are not permanently reusable. Over time, media fatigue reduces performance and replacement becomes necessary.

What micron rating is best for hydraulic oil filtration?

Common hydraulic filters range from 3 to 25 microns. The optimal rating depends on system sensitivity and manufacturer specifications.

What happens if a hydraulic oil filter is not replaced on time?

Delayed replacement can cause pressure loss, valve sticking, pump wear, and reduced system efficiency, leading to costly downtime.

What is the difference between a coalescer filter and a separator filter?

They are two distinct technologies often used together to remove liquids from a gas or liquid stream. The key difference is their core function:

A Coalescer Filter merges tiny, invisible liquid droplets into large, heavy ones.

A Separator Filter catches and drains those large droplets from the flow.

How They Work:

Coalescer: The stream passes through a special media (like fine fibers). Microscopic aerosol droplets collide and merge (coalesce) into drops large enough to drain. It solves the problem of suspended mist.

Separator: The flow then enters a chamber with baffles or vanes. The now-large droplets hit the surfaces, fall out by gravity, and collect in a sump. It provides the final, clean separation.
